  • Patent number: 5071321
    Abstract: The bellows in the stroke control valve of a variable stroke axial piston wobble plate refrigerant compressor is partially filled with an anti-freeze solution and continuously exposed to both suction pressure and crankcase pressure. This has the effect of reducing the piston stroke at high compressor speeds while increasing suction pressure to maintain some air conditioning performance.

  • Patent number: 5022234
    Abstract: A control method for a variable capacity automotive air conditioning compressor in which the compressor operating point is tailored to the nonlinear control characteristics of variable displacement compressors. When the error between the desired and actual values of a specified system parameter is relatively large, the operating point is determined by a coarse gain closed-loop control. When the error is within a fine control range defined in relation to the desired value, the control point is set to one of three predetermined values for effecting small displacement increases, small displacement decreases, or no change in displacement. An adaptive tuning technique is used to update the predetermined control point values to compensate for compressor-to-compressor differences and changes in the operating conditions of a given compressor system. An anticipation technique shortens the transition from coarse control to fine control by minimizing gross overshoots of the specified system parameter.

  • Patent number: 4969334
    Abstract: A control method for a variable capacity automotive engine driven air conditioning compressor in which the onset of an overspeed condition is anticipated in relation to the compressor speed and acceleration for the purpose of initiating an override of the normal control setting to quickly destroke the compressor so long as the overspeed condition is indicated. In normal operation, the control setting for the air conditioning system is chosen in relation to the current compressor speed. The compressor capacity is electrically controlled in relation to the error between the control setting and an actual or measured setting. Concurrently, a secondary control setting is determined based on an estimate of a future compressor speed, given the current rate of change in compressor speed. When the secondary control setting would produce more destroke than the primary control setting, the secondary control overrides the primary control to protect the compressor should the current conditions continue.

  • Patent number: 4872814
    Abstract: A passive destroker mechanism operated by centrifugal force is added to a variable stroke axial piston wobble plate refrigerant compressor. The destroker operates at a predetermined compressor speed to communicate the discharge side of the compressor with its sealed crankcase to thereby provide a controlled discharge gas bleed thereto to destroke the compressor to a desired displacement. Then after the speed is reduced below such trigger speed, the destroker mechanism operates to return the compressor to its normal stroke control condition.
